Key Differences
In short — Core i5-14400F outperforms the cheaper Core i3-7350K on the selected game parameters. However, the worse performing Core i3-7350K is a better bang for your buck. The better performing Core i5-14400F is 2561 days newer than the cheaper Core i3-7350K.
Advantages of Intel Core i3-7350K
- Up to 75% cheaper than Core i5-14400F - $37.73 vs $153.54
- Up to 74% better value when playing Valorant than Core i5-14400F - $0.05 vs $0.19 per FPS
- Works without a dedicated GPU, while Intel Core i5-14400F doesn't have integrated graphics
Advantages of Intel Core i5-14400F
- Performs up to 14% better in Valorant than Core i3-7350K - 894 vs 781 FPS
- Can execute more multi-threaded tasks simultaneously than Intel Core i3-7350K - 16 vs 4 threads

Geekbench 5 Benchmarks
Intel Core i3-7350K | vs | Intel Core i5-14400F |
---|---|---|
Jan 3rd, 2017 | Release Date | Jan 8th, 2024 |
Core i3 | Collection | Core i5 |
Kaby Lake | Codename | Raptor Lake |
Intel Socket 1151 | Socket | Intel Socket 1700 |
Desktop | Segment | Desktop |
2 | Cores | 10 |
4 | Threads | 16 |
4.2 GHz | Base Clock Speed | 2.5 GHz |
Non-Turbo | Turbo Clock Speed | 4.7 GHz |
60 W | TDP | Not Available |
14 nm | Process Size | 10 nm |
42.0x | Multiplier | 25.0x |
Intel HD 630 | Integrated Graphics | None |
Yes | Overclockable | No |
